Norway - Game Meat Net Production

Since 2014, Norway Game Meat Net Production decreased by 0.5% year on year. At $15,052.08 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, the country was number 38 comparing other countries in Game Meat Net Production. Norway is overtaken by Austria, which was number 37 at $15,123.74 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006 and is followed by Spain with $15,024.45 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006. Papua New Guinea lead the ranking with $919,719.42 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, +1.2% versus 2018. United States, Nigeria and Ivory Coast resp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Chad witnessed the best average annual growth at +4.3% per year, while Iran was the worst growing country at -2.9% per year.
